Dental cleanings are important for preventing the growth of harmful bacteria and slowing the progression of gingivitis and periodontal disease (aka gum disease).
Both gingivitis and periodontal disease have been scientifically linked to a wide range of other inflammatory conditions. These include heart disease, stroke, diabetes, arthritis, Alzheimer’s, and even some cancers.
Prevention is key. At your scheduled hygiene appointment, we look for signs of developing oral disease and other dental problems that could affect your overall health. We then discuss options for addressing them, including home care, dietary and lifestyle changes, or corrective dental treatment.

The other component of these visits is cleaning – or, to use the clinical term, prophylaxis. There are three big benefits to a professional cleaning.

Benefits of Professional Cleaning
Plaque and Calculus Removal
Tartar and plaque can build up above the gum line and unseen below it, ultimately leading to periodontal disease. Even when you brush and floss regularly at home, it can be impossible to remove all of the debris and bacteria that cause this. Our hygienists are specially trained to locate and remove this harmful buildup that can damage your health.
Brighter and Whiter Teeth
A healthier looking smile. Even with brushing and flossing at home, food and beverages can stain teeth over time. Coffee, tea, red wine, and foods can all contribute to brown or yellow tooth stains. Dental cleanings help remove them so your smile looks brighter and whiter.
Fresher Breath
Some bad breath (halitosis) can’t be controlled at home, especially when gum disease is involved. Bacteria builds up and food particles decay below the gum line. Prophylaxis removes all of this debris so your breath is refreshed.
